📅  最后修改于: 2023-12-03 14:55:42.658000             🧑  作者: Mango
在Linux操作系统中,有一个称为SELinux(Security Enhanced Linux)的安全机制,用于控制系统中进程和用户的访问权限。在进行系统维护和安全管理时,检查SELinux状态非常重要。
以下是如何检查SELinux状态的方法:
要查看SELinux是否启用,可以使用以下命令:
sestatus
该命令将返回有关SELinux当前状态的信息,包括:
如果SELinux启用并处于enforcing模式下,则它将强制执行策略并禁用任何不符合安全策略的活动。
SELinux配置文件位于/etc/selinux/config。可以通过查看此文件来确定SELinux是否已启用并处于enforcing模式下。
打开文件,查找SELINUX=行。如果它的值是enabled并且另一行中MODE=的值是enforcing,则SELinux已启用并处于enforcing模式下。
vi /etc/selinux/config
要修改SELinux状态,请修改/etc/selinux/config文件。例如,要禁用SELinux,将SELINUX=的值更改为disabled。
vi /etc/selinux/config
然后,重新启动系统以使更改生效。
SELinux是Linux系统的一个重要保护层。我们可以通过sestatus或/etc/selinux/config文件查看和修改当前SELinux状态。一旦禁用SELinux,可能会降低系统的安全性,因此建议仅在必要时禁用SELinux。